Recovered patients
In the past twenty-four hours, 212 patients with la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 diagnosis recovered and were discharged from care across the republic, including: in Bishkek city – 74 patients, Osh city – 13, Chuy province – 55, Osh province – 2, Talas province – 10, Naryn province – 7, Issyk-Kul province – 25, Jalal-Abad province – 21, and Batken province – 5.
The total number of recoveries during the entire period: 76 563 patients.

New cases
As of January 3rd, 2021, a total of 91 new cases of la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 were registered across the republic in the past twenty-four hours. These include: Bishkek city – 34, Osh city – 1, Chuy province – 37, Osh province – 2, Talas province – 2, Naryn province – 6, Issyk-Kul province – 6, Jalal-Abad province – 0, Batken province – 3.
Overall, 81 305 cases were registered during the entire period, including 42 576 laboratory-confirmed cases and 38 729 cases confirmed based on clinical and epidemiological data.

1 365 PCR tests were carried out in the past twenty-four hours.
Receiving treatment
Currently, a total of 980 patients throughout the republic are receiving inpatient care, while 1485 patients are in outpatient care.
The number of patients in the inpatient facilities comprises: in Bishkek city – 335, Osh city – 38, Chuy province – 253, Osh province – 71, Talas province – 18, Naryn province – 30, Issyk-Kul province – 114, Jalal-Abad province – 71, Batken province – 50. Out of the 980 patients receiving inpatient care, the condition of 14 people (1.4%) is categorized as satisfactory, 671 patients (68.4%) are in moderately severe condition, 245 (25%) in severe and 50 (5.1%) in critical condition.
The number of patients with la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 who are receiving outpatient (at home) treatment comprises: in Bishkek city – 516, Osh city – 57, Chuy province – 380, Osh province – 66, Talas province – 43, Naryn province – 28, Issyk-Kul province – 282, Jalal-Abad province – 70, Batken province – 43.
Fatalities
One (1) death due to laboratory-confirmed COVID-19 was registered (Bishkek) in the past twenty-four hours. The overall death toll due to COVID-19 in the republic comprises 1359 cases, including 417 laboratory-confirmed cases and 942 cases confirmed based on clinical and epidemiological data.
Medical workers
No new COVID-19 cases were registered among medical workers in the past twenty-four hours. The total number of medical workers diagnosed with COVID-19 is 4120. In the past twenty-four hours, 4 medical workers were discharged from inpatient care, and 2 medical workers were released from self-isolation at home. In total, 3938 medical workers have recovered in the republic
